当前位置: 首页 > news >正文

终极指南:如何让老旧Android电视焕发新生,打造流畅直播体验

终极指南:如何让老旧Android电视焕发新生,打造流畅直播体验

【免费下载链接】mytv-android使用Android原生开发的视频播放软件项目地址: https://gitcode.com/gh_mirrors/my/mytv-android

你有一台运行Android 4.4+的老旧智能电视,总是卡顿、频道少、无法安装现代应用?这款专为低配置设备优化的原生Android电视直播软件,正是你需要的解决方案。通过原生开发技术,它能在老旧电视上实现2秒内启动、0.5秒快速换台的流畅体验,让老设备重新发挥价值。

🚀 为什么选择原生Android方案?

传统混合开发应用(基于WebView)在老旧设备上表现不佳,而原生Android开发直接调用系统API,带来显著优势:

  • 内存占用降低30-40%:无需加载网页渲染引擎,资源消耗大幅减少
  • 启动速度提升50%以上:在联发科MTK8691等老旧芯片上测试,2秒内即可启动
  • 系统兼容性广泛:支持Android 4.4(API 19)至Android 13(API 33)全版本
  • 流畅播放体验:采用兼容性层设计,即使缺乏硬件加速也能稳定解码

📱 三大主题界面,适配各种设备

Leanback主题专为大屏幕电视优化,图标放大150%,支持10米外清晰可见,完美适配遥控器操作。Mobile主题针对触控设备设计,竖屏布局自适应分辨率,保证触控区域精准。Pad主题提供分屏显示,动态调整布局密度,关键信息优先展示。

⚙️ 一键配置自定义直播源

自定义直播源配置从未如此简单:

  1. 进入设置界面 → 选择"直播源"选项
  2. 点击"自定义直播源"输入框,输入m3u8格式源地址
  3. 设置缓存时间(建议老旧设备设为24小时减少网络请求)
  4. 启用"数字选台"功能,通过遥控器数字键快速切换
  5. 点击"应用"保存,系统自动验证并加载直播源

安全建议:仅使用HTTPS协议直播源,通过MD5校验验证文件完整性,定期更新直播源地址。

🔄 智能多线路切换与频道管理

软件支持多线路自动切换功能,同一频道拥有多个播放地址:

  • 智能线路选择:播放失败时自动切换到下一个可用线路
  • 域名记忆功能:成功播放的线路域名自动加入"可播放域名列表"
  • 优先匹配:播放时优先选择匹配可播放域名列表的线路

频道收藏功能让观看更便捷:在选台界面长按OK键或长按屏幕即可收藏/取消收藏频道。移动到频道列表顶部再按上方向键,即可切换显示收藏列表。

🌐 家庭共享与多设备同步

通过本地网络共享功能,同一局域网内最多5台设备可同步直播源:

  1. 在主设备开启"家庭共享"开关
  2. 其他设备选择"加入家庭网络"
  3. 输入主设备显示的6位验证码完成配对

技术原理基于XML文件的本地HTTP服务(端口8080),支持电视、手机、平板多设备同步。家长控制功能可设置观看时段限制和内容过滤,通过密码保护防止儿童访问不适宜频道。

🛠️ 技术架构与源码解析

项目采用原生Android开发,源码结构清晰:

  • 核心模块app/src/main/java/top/yogiczy/mytv/包含所有主要功能
  • 界面层activities/处理不同设备类型的Activity
  • 数据层data/repositories/管理直播源、节目单等数据
  • UI组件ui/screens/实现三大主题界面

编译指南请参考项目内的README.md文档,或直接下载release页面的APK文件安装使用。

🔧 常见问题快速解决

播放卡顿怎么办?

  • 检查网络连接,建议使用5GHz WiFi或有线连接
  • 增加缓存时间(设置 > 直播源 > 缓存时间)
  • 降低视频质量(设置 > 播放 > 画质选择)

频道无法加载?

  • 验证直播源地址有效性(可在电脑端测试)
  • 清除应用缓存(设置 > 应用 > 清除缓存)
  • 更新软件至最新版本(设置 > 更新 > 检查更新)

♻️ 环保价值:延长设备寿命

从环保角度看,延长老旧电视的使用寿命相当于减少约150公斤电子垃圾产生。这款开源直播软件通过技术优化,使原本可能被淘汰的设备重新具备实用价值,不仅为用户节省更换设备的开支,更在全球电子垃圾日益严重的背景下,贡献一份环保力量。

📥 如何获取与使用?

源码获取

git clone https://gitcode.com/gh_mirrors/my/mytv-android

直接安装:下载release页面的APK文件进行安装

系统要求:仅支持Android 5.0及以上版本,网络环境必须支持IPv6

这款专为老旧Android电视优化的直播软件,通过原生开发技术和智能功能设计,让每一台老设备都能焕发新生。无论是流畅的播放体验、便捷的自定义配置,还是环保的再利用价值,都让它成为老旧智能电视用户的最佳选择。

【免费下载链接】mytv-android使用Android原生开发的视频播放软件项目地址: https://gitcode.com/gh_mirrors/my/mytv-android

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1100282/

相关文章:

  • 【学习记录】Week2(五):对抗与伪装——反调试检测与 ptrace 绕过实战
  • Unity GPU 合批优化详解
  • 市场正规的画册设计公司口碑
  • 互联网医院系统实现诊疗服务的闭环管理
  • MiMo免费体验金
  • WebRTC远程屏幕共享:浏览器直连桌面的终极解决方案
  • Python爬虫经典案例013:爬虫数据存储方案MongoDB——文档型数据库的数据管理艺术
  • 零基础谷歌收录排查问题:外贸站常见5个坑
  • Temperature:AI 的“脑洞旋钮”
  • 成教 / 专升本论文不会写?笔墨 AI 流程化引导,零基础也能搭好论文框架
  • 七大排序算法全解析:从插入到三路快排,手把手带你掌握核心思想与实战陷阱
  • Obsidian+AI+飞书:搭建一个会自进化的知识库
  • 货架图像识别系统需要哪些核心能力?从5层链路拆解技术选型
  • 独立站搭建平台有哪些?外贸官网、跨境商城和开源方案对比
  • 计算机Java毕设实战-基于 SpringBoot 的棋牌馆收银计费管理系统的设计与实现 基于 SpringBoot 的棋牌室会员消费管理系统【完整源码+LW+部署说明+演示视频,全bao一条龙等】
  • GHelper终极指南:如何让华硕笔记本性能翻倍,告别臃肿控制中心
  • 2026智能门锁行业白皮书:42%投诉增长背后的核心消费警示
  • ParsecVDisplay虚拟显示器终极指南:5分钟搭建Windows高性能虚拟显示系统
  • 【 Godot 4 学习笔记】Blender到Godot4
  • VASP四大输入文件详解:POSCAR、POTCAR、KPOINTS、INCAR
  • Linux内核开发入门:从零构建内核模块与实验环境
  • 【课程设计/毕业设计】基于 SpringBoot 的棋牌室日常营业监管系统的设计与实现 基于 SpringBoot 的休闲棋牌服务管理系统【附源码、数据库、万字文档】
  • Flutter 应用加固方法 从 Dart 混淆到 IPA 层面的保护方案
  • MATLAB实战:用fitdist函数搞定风光数据Weibull和Beta分布拟合(附完整代码)
  • Python爬虫经典案例003:正则表达式精通指南——文本数据的精准提取技巧
  • 资本热捧灵巧手,估值逼近宇树!是“宁德时代”还是被本体厂商围剿?
  • 城市空气质量改善优选雾森系统 吸附悬浮浮尘净化园区空气环境
  • 域名能解析但网站打不开?六层排查比反复重启更快
  • 深圳机器人热潮来袭:越疆科技冲击创业板,“八大金刚”融资引关注
  • NL2SQL 在复杂数仓里为什么不稳?从语义建模看数据问答架构